News Focus
News Focus
Replies to #71673 on Biotech Values
icon url

go seek

01/16/09 7:16 PM

#71675 RE: DewDiligence #71673

What are the 4 countries where Teva Pharmaceuticals has FoB manufacturing facilities?

i was gonna say this earlier, teach... last shot for tonite.